Q1Consider the following statements regarding PM Narendra Modi's State Visit to Seychelles (27-29 June 2026): 1. India extended a Line of Credit of Rs 1,250 crore to Seychelles. 2. Modi was the first Indian Prime Minister to address the Seychelles National Assembly. Which of the statements given above is/are correct?

A 1 only
B Both 1 and 2
C 2 only
D Neither 1 nor 2
Explanation

Both statements are correct. During the visit, India extended a Line of Credit of Rs 1,250 crore to Seychelles, and PM Modi became the first Indian Prime Minister to address a special session of the Seychelles National Assembly. A joint logo marking 50 years of diplomatic ties was also released.
